Lead The Way To Excellence

The Executive Director, PayerRelations & Contracting has system level responsibility for providing strategic and operational leadership in the development and execution of all types of payer contracting programs. This role will ensure that payer contracts support the financial and operational goals of the organization while maintaining compliance with regulatory requirements.

What We’re Looking For

  • Master’s degree in Business Administration, Healthcare Administration or related field and approximately fifteen years of progressively responsible related experience that includes payer contracting, physician group practice operations, payer/health plan operations, finance, and/or clinical operations management.
  • Knowledge and vision regarding the changing healthcare payment & delivery model including value-based reimbursement, risk-based arrangements, population health dynamics, provider organization relationships, etc.
  • Demonstrated success in developing and meeting financial performance objectives
  • Exceptional interpersonal, leadership, relationship-management, and communication skills
  • Serve as the primary point of contact with payers to negotiate facility payer contracts on behalf of MHC.
  • Work with finance to model financial impacts of proposed payor contract changes and recommend contractual models & terms to MHC executive leadership for approval.
  • Coordinate management of payer contracts. Ensure coordination with payment validation processes within the Revenue Cycle team.
  • Engage with payers in Joint Operating Committees as appropriate as well as coordinating resolution of payment issues and denials with MHC revenue cycle and payors.
  • Evaluate payer partnership opportunities & opportunities to align disparate payer contracts across MHC on an ongoing basis
  • Represent the at appropriate community, hospital, regional, statewide or national meetings. Maintains open communication with the community, employers, payers, and other key stakeholders in the area of health care.
  • Collaborate with Corporate Reimbursement on matters such as, fee increases and financial analysis of new programs or initiatives.
  • Collaborate with Executive Director CIN/PHO Payer Relations on issues with payers
